Johnnie Walker A Song of Ice Whisky features single malts from Clynelish, one of Scotland’s most northern distilleries, and exudes a crisp, clean taste like the unforgiving force of ice that shapes mountains and stops rivers. The new blend has an ABV of 40.2% and the bottle design evokes an icy setting with frosted blue and gray colors inspired by the North, known for its cold winters and frozen landscapes.
A Song of Ice is linked to the House Stark, and it boasts a crisp, clean flavour profile in reference to the icy climes of the North. There’s a helping of Clynelish single malt in this one, which is rather apt, considering the distillery’s particularly northern locale. Tasting Notes Of Johnnie Walker Song Of Ice Whisky
Nose:
 Layers of vanilla and honey, followed by cedar, orange oil, mint leaf and heather.
Palate:
 Yellow plum, red grapes and green apples, plus barley and brown sugar. A soft hint of earthy, grassy peat in the background.
Finish:
The fresh fruits from the palate stick around for the finish.
